Yeshiva Shaare Torah

Yeshiva Shaare Torah serves 855 students in grades Prekindergarten-12, is a member of the National Society of Hebrew Day Schools (NSHDS). Yeshiva Shaare Torah religious affiliation is Jewish.

In what neighborhood is Yeshiva Shaare Torah located?
Yeshiva Shaare Torah is located in the Midwood neighborhood of Brooklyn, NY. There are 28 other private schools located in Midwood.
